Felix Johannes Christiaan Gryseels

In Memorial

1928 ~ 2017

Peacefully at the age of 88, with his family by his side, Felix Gryseels passed away in Pinawa on February 3, 2017.  Left to cherish his memory are his daughter Gertie (Gerry), grandsons Richard, and Ryan (Melissa), great grandson Austin, great granddaughter Amber; his son Frank (Janneke), grandsons Rutger and Jeroen (Meighan).   He also leaves to mourn his brothers Wil, Cass, Appie, Michel, sisters Mia, and Weiss, sister-in-law Tina, and their spouses and sister-in-law Helga as well as numerous nieces, nephews and extended family in the Netherlands and Germany.  Felix was predeceased by his son Louie, his wife Gertie, his partner Truus, brothers Pietje and Geert, sister-in-law Tiny; bother in-law Willy, and his parents Anna and Aloysius Gryseels.

Felix was born in Tegelen, The Netherlands.  He married the love of his life Gertie in 1954 and they immigrated to Winnipeg, MB Canada where they had three children.  He was employed as a welder in Winnipeg until 1966 when he commenced employment with Atomic Energy of Canada and moved his family to Pinawa. He was proud of his career successes and retired from AECL as a Machine Shop Foreman (Tool & Dye Maker) in May 1991.

Following the death of his wife Gertie in 1990 and his retirement in 1991, Felix returned to the Netherlands where a year later he met his second partner, Truus.  Over several years, they traveled extensively in Europe and Canada.  He returned to Canada many times for visits with his children.  When Truus died in 2013, Felix suffered a stroke and returned to Canada to live with his children.  It was his wish to spend the remainder of his days in the peace and beauty of Pinawa.

Felix had a zest for life.  He enjoyed card playing, fishing and many sports – especially golf and in the earlier years curling.  He was an avid soccer fan and especially enjoyed watching his children play various sports.  He loved to have a good time and especially enjoyed the accomplishments of his children and grandsons.  He was elated with the birth of his great grandchildren and they held a special bond.  He was always happy to share stories of his homeland and life experiences with his family.

Cremation has taken place and upon Felix’s request a private family service and interment will be held at a later date at the Pinawa Cemetery.  In lieu of flowers, donations can be made to the Pinawa Hospital – Cancercare Unit.
